android - 我如何测试是否没有互联网和其他网络场景
问题描述
我的应用程序连接到纽约时报 api,并且需要测试如果设备上没有互联网、它自身的 api 不起作用或可能发生的任何其他网络问题会发生什么。
解决方案
如果手动测试 - 只需打开飞行模式。
如果编写一个测试模拟你的 HTTP 库以返回连接失败,则调用 API。
推荐阅读
- angular - Angular2 和 Highcharts 地图 - 地图气泡未显示
- mongodb - 更改后的火花持久文档
- django - 扩展 django UserCreationForm
- java - 检查字符是否在字符串中的错误位置
- azure - 将应用程序推送到具有 Microsft Azure 依赖项的 PCF 云时出现 Nullpointer 异常
- python - 从 Mac 和 Ubuntu 如何从 python 连接 Windows 共享路径并列出文件并复制
- python-3.x - 无法在基本多处理程序中读取队列
- node.js - Nodejs Exec不执行
- ios - 为什么某些屏幕类在 Firebase Analytics 中完全合格?
- sql-server - SQL Server 代理命令窗口中的多个存储过程调用是并行运行还是顺序运行?